A 10-member larger bench has been constituted on the direction of Chief Justice of Pakistan Justice Gulzar Ahmed to hear the petition seeking review of the presidential reference filed against Justice Qazi Fai Issa. Geo News Reported on Tuesday.
Earlier, a six-member bench headed by Justice Umar Ata Bandial had referred the matter to Chief Justice Gulzar Ahmed, after which the Chief Justice constituted a bench to hear the case.
Justice Umar Ata Bandial will preside over a 10-member bench, which will also include the judge who wrote the dissenting note in the presidential reference against Judge Isa.
Sources said that Justice Mansoor Ali Shah, Justice Yahya Afridi and Justice Maqbool Baqir are part of the bench while Justice Aminuddin Khan has been included in the bench due to the retirement of Justice Faisal Arab. The case is set to be heard on March 1.
